# Provenance Notes: Websocket Compression

Quick context for on-call: the Fernpipe gateway ships two builds — one with permessage-deflate on, one with it off. Compression saves us bandwidth but spikes CPU under fan-out load, so we flip between them during incidents. Before you toggle anything, confirm which build is actually deployed; the dashboards lie sometimes. The currently pinned build token is listed below.

pipeline stamp: htk9_ce63042d9

## TKT-441: Telemetry gateway firmware cutover

The Furrowlink gateway for the harvester fleet moves to the v9 firmware channel this release. Changes: CAN-bus sampling interval drops to 500ms, offline buffering extends to 72 hours, and the legacy modem path is removed. Field units must be staged in batches of 50; rollback requires physical access, so do not skip the canary group. Sign-off is required before the cutover script runs. The person responsible for sign-off is named below.

account owner for bawip-tahag: Raleth Quenok

Q3 Planning Note — Sales Leads

As flagged last month, we are taking a write-down on remaining Corvelle Series 4 stock held at the Dunmarsh warehouse. Demand for the line fell sharply after the Series 5 launch, and carrying costs no longer justify storage. Finance will book the adjustment this quarter; expect a visible hit to regional margin figures. Please stop quoting Series 4 in new proposals effective immediately. The adjustment also shapes our direction for next year, summarized below.

internal memo for kahop-yajof: The steering committee signed off on a budget of $12.6 million for Project Jorwyn. The renewal with Quenoxox Logistics closes at $16.8 million a year, 48 percent above the last contract.